Support asynchronous tests (#600)
* Tweak the implementation of heap closures This commit updates the implementation of the `Closure` type to internally store an `Rc` and be suitable for dropping a `Closure` during the execution of the closure. This is currently needed for promises but may be generally useful as well! * Support asynchronous tests This commit adds support for executing tests asynchronously. This is modeled by tests returning a `Future` instead of simply executing inline, and is signified with `#[wasm_bindgen_test(async)]`. Support for this is added through a new `wasm-bindgen-futures` crate which is a binding between the `futures` crate and JS `Promise` objects. Lots more details can be found in the details of the commit, but one of the end results is that the `web-sys` tests are now entirely contained in the same test suite and don't need `npm install` to be run to execute them! * Review tweaks * Add some bindings for `Function.call` to `js_sys` Name them `call0`, `call1`, `call2`, ... for the number of arguments being passed. * Use oneshots channels with `JsFuture` It did indeed clean up the implementation!
